In 2012, all mobile phones in the U.S. will be 3.5-mm and MicroUSB-jack

Earlier there were reports that mobile phone manufacturers are going to standardize the connectors of mobile phones and accessories. In other words, in the perspective of accessories can be common to different models and even for devices from different manufacturers. In the countries of Europe to the same standards expected to come next year, but in the U.S., perhaps before the year 2012 this is not expected.

At least, CTIA Wireless Association reported that U.S. phones with the same set of connectors appear in 2012. As an audio jack to be used 3.5-mm, and for charging and syncing with your computer - MicroUSB. Thus, for different models of mobile phones can be used the same headphones and power supplies. For the general standards in this field stands and the Federal Communications Commission (FCC).
